Camila Alarcon-Chelecki

Assitant Director Office Of Community Health And Safety at City of Pittsburgh

Camila Alarcon-Chelecki, MSPPM, serves as the Assistant Director of the Office of Community Health and Safety for the City of Pittsburgh since October 2021, previously holding roles as Senior Project Manager and LEAD Project Coordinator. Prior experience includes positions at Guatemala Visible, where successes included winning international grants totaling $340,000 and implementing projects to enhance public administration transparency. As the Co-Founder and Executive Director of Red Nacional por la Integridad, Camila established a national youth network and secured a USAID grant, marking a significant achievement for a Guatemalan non-profit. Camila’s career also encompasses roles in academia as a teaching assistant and valuable contributions as a political consultant and columnist throughout various organizations. Educational credentials include a Master’s in Public Policy and Management from Carnegie Mellon University and a Bachelor’s in Political Science from Grinnell College.
